Electricity Distribution Advanced Apprenticeship

3 months ago


Nottingham, United Kingdom National Grid Electricity Distribution Full time

Job Introduction
The Apprenticeship programme takes around three years to complete, and you’ll spend your first 12 weeks being inducted onto the programme at one of our Training Centres. You’ll earn while you learn and develop your knowledge, skills and behaviours to become a Power Networks Craftsperson, achieving a City & Guilds Level 2 Qualification in Electrical Engineering. Your Training will include periods of on the job training and development, learning from an experienced and qualified Craftsperson. Following a formal assessment of your knowledge, skills and behaviours, you’ll become a qualified Craftsperson yourself.

A Power Networks Craftsperson has responsibility for the safe construction, maintenance and repair of the electrical power network. You’ll work on distribution systems up to 66kV (or 132kV if in a Projects team). You can be a Jointer, Fitter, or Overhead Linesperson. We have one Overhead, one Fitter and two Jointer positions available at our Nottingham depot.

Whichever pathway you pursue, you’ll represent National Grid and carry out work handed down by other areas of the business.

Main Responsibilities
**Our Trades**

**Underground cable engineer (Jointer). **Our jointers carry out jointing techniques up to 66kV*, including excavation, cable laying, reinstatement and fault location on LV cables

**Overhead lines engineer (Linesperson). **Our Overhead Lines teams carry out the construction, maintenance, replacement and repair of overhead lines up to and including 66kV*.

**Substation fitting engineer (Fitter). **Our fitters carry out the annual maintenance of plant and switchgear up to 66kV*. They’re also responsible for the programming and monitoring of immediate work colleagues and switching up to 66kV*, among other tasks.
- Projects teams work up to voltages of 132kV

Join us, and we’ll see you participate in craft skills activities on the live LV network, on dead LV, HV and EHV circuits (live HV circuits if part of a Hot Glove team). You’ll help with network operations, connect generators and services and organise your own projects. You’ll also:

- Construct distribution substations, construct and alter overhead lines, install plant, lay and joint cables, terminate cables to plant and overhead lines
- Carry out routine inspection, maintenance and repairs of underground, overhead, substation and protection equipment
- Record asset routes, details and positions
- Record plant details
- Locate and identify cables, test insulation, phasing and continuity on LV cables
- Test earthing, voltage, phasing and phase rotation
- Write outage requests and switching programmes for simple outages

Our minimum entry criteria require the following qualifications (held or predicted):

- GCSE English at Grade A*-C/9-4 or Level 2 Functional/Key Skills English
- GCSE Mathematics at Grade A*-C/9-4 or Level 2 Functional/Key Skills Maths
- GCSE Science at Grade A*-C/9-4 or BTEC Science Level 2 equivalent

Start date **September 2024**. Please note that we are unable to accommodate any annual leave during these first 12 weeks of training.
